30 Injured, 7 In Critical Condition, After Vehicle Drives Into LA Nightclub Crowd

Topline

Thirty people were injured after a car drove into a crowd in Los Angeles early Saturday morning, leaving seven bystanders in critical condition, as more than 100 first responders are at scene.

Key Facts

Los Angeles Fire Department Spokesperson Adam VanGerpen told reporters “somebody had lost consciousness inside the vehicle,” saying the car, a Nissan Versa, ran into a large group of people outside a club in East Hollywood.

One patient had a gunshot wound, according to VanGerpen.

LAFD said in a 7:20 a.m. EDT update that 124 fire personnel responded to the scene in which seven were left in critical condition and six in serious condition.
